Your Carbon Footprint

We've all heard about carbon footprints but what does it actually mean?

We all, by our everyday activities, have an impact on the environment and in particular climate change. Greenhouse gases are produced in our day-to-day lives through burning fossil fuels for electricity, heating and transportation etc. The carbon footprint is a measurement of all greenhouse gases we individually produce and has units of tonnes (or kg) of carbon dioxide equivalent.

So how can we reduce our carbon footprint?

Switch off your TV! Joking aside, electricity is one of the biggest carbon emitters so switching off electrical items when not in use is a great start. Here are some other suggestions to get started which could actually save you money as well:

1. Sign up to a green energy supplier, who will supply electricity from renewable sources (e.g. wind and hydroelectric power) - this will reduce your carbon footprint contribution from electricity to zero
2. Turn down the central heating slightly (try just 1 to 2 degrees C)
3. Turn down the water heating setting (just 2 degrees will make a significant saving)
4. Check the central heating timer setting - remember there is no point heating the house after you have left for work
5. Fill your dishwasher and washing machine with a full load - this will save you water, electricity and washing powder
6. Fill the kettle with only as much water as you need
7. Hang out the washing to dry rather than tumble drying it

In terms of travel and work :

1. Why not car share to work or use public transport?
2. For short journeys either walk or cycle
3. See if your employer will allow you to work from home one day a week
4. Next time you replace your car - check out diesel engines. 
5. When on holiday - hire a bicycle to explore locally rather than a car
6. When staying away turn the lights and air-conditioning off when you leave your room
7. Do you switch your PC and office lights off at the end of your working day?
